zebra: Add a timer to nexthop group deletion

Before deleting nexthop groups, that are installed,
from the system, start a timer and hold the nexthop
group for that time.

Suppose you have this scenario

a) create a static route with 1 x ecmp
      creates a nhg with 1 x ecmp
b) create a static route with 2 x ecmp
      creates a nhg with 2 x ecmp
      deletes a's nhg
c) create a static route with 3 x ecmp
      creates a nhg with 3 x ecmp
      deletes b's nhg
d) create a different route with 1 x ecmp
      creates another 1 x ecmp ( since a's ecmp was deleted )
e) create a different route with 2 x ecmp
      creates another 2 x ecmp ( since b's ecmp was deleted )

If you don't delete the nhg, start a timer, the nhg's used
in steps a and b can be reused for steps d and e.  This reduces
overhead work with zebra <-> kernel interactions and improves
the speed of the system.

So modify the code to note that an installed nexthop group should
be kept around a bit and hopefully reused.

/*
* When deleting a NHG notice that it is still installed
* and if it is, slightly delay the actual removal to
* the future. So that upper level protocols might
* be able to take advantage of some NHG's that
* are there
*/
#define NEXTHOP_GROUP_KEEP_AROUND (1 << 6)
